All members of the University community who are regularly exposed to occupational noise levels at or exceeding an 8-hour time-weighted average of 85 dBA must enroll in the Hearing Conservation Program (HCP). Create a Consistent Flow Direction: Most flows are top-to-bottom or left-to-right, but you shouldn't mix these directional flows. The flow should be in the same direction throughout. The arrows should all go left to right if your flowchart goes left to right.
